
SPECIAL EVENING WITH CAROL BURNETT, A (TV)
Summary
The finale of "The Carol Burnett Show," a series of comedy/variety programs featuring Carol Burnett. Burnett, Tim Conway, and Vicki Lawrence reminisce about past shows and introduce excerpts spanning the eleven years of the show. Highlights include the following: Burnett does her Tarzan yell; Burnett performs in duets with such guests as Liza Minnelli, Ella Fitzgerald, Perry Como, Ray Charles, Bing Crosby, Rock Hudson, Steve Lawrence, and Eydie GormŽ; in a comic skit, Burt Reynolds sings "As Time Goes By"; Burnett and Conway appear as Mrs. Wiggins and Mr. Tudball; Jimmy Stewart accompanies himself on the piano and sings "Ragtime Cowboy Joe"; in comic skits, Harvey Korman sings "They Call the Wind Maria" and Burnett sings "Come Rain or Come Shine," "The Lady Is a Tramp," and "You Light Up My Life"; movies are parodied, including "The African Queen" and "The Postman Always Rings Twice." Additional highlights include the following: Lawrence sings "The Night the Lights Went Out in Georgia" and a spoof of a country-and-western song; Bing Crosby and Bob Hope appear in a restaurant skit; in his first sketch in the series, Conway performs the role of a sports commentator; a "Columbo" parody is featured; Dick Van Dyke appears in a comic sketch; Burnett and Lawrence appear as Eunice and her Mama in a new sketch where Eunice consults a psychiatrist, played by Craig Richard Nelson; the Ernie Flatt Dancers perform a modern dance number; bloopers and outtakes are included from previous shows featuring the regulars; and Burnett as the Cleaning Lady talks about why she is ending the show and sings her closing theme.
